New JF-2 EX Rockabilly Guitar from Peavey

Peavey introduces its new JF-2 EX guitar, a rockabilly flavored, archtop semi-hollowbody based on Peavey's JF-1 jazz/fusion guitar.
The Peavey JF-2 combines the playing comfort of the JF-1 with high-output pickups, a vintage tremolo tailpiece and expressive sparkle-paint finishes. The JF-2 also features a thin, lightweight maple ply guitar body with solid veneer top; mahogany neck with rosewood fretboard; Grover tuning keys; and cream binding on the body. The guitar's electronics package includes two volume controls, two tone controls and a three-way, toggle-style pickup selector. The distinctive stylings of the JF-2 are complemented by its unique Peavey sound.
The JF-2 EX guitar will be available in Q3 2005 from authorized Peavey retailers.
Features:
- 24 3/4" scale with 22 frets
- Lightweight, maple-ply semi-hollowbody
- Slightly angled, set mahogany neck with rosewood fretboard
- Vintage tremolo tailpiece and articulating bridge
- Chrome hardware and Grover tuning keys
- Two high-output Peavey mini-bucking pickups
- Two volume controls and two tone controls
- Three-way, toggle-style pickup selector
- Available in gold sparkle, silver sparkle and red sparkle
- U.S. MSRP $499.99
